Pour les articles homonymes, voir Rosario (homonymie).Edwin Rosario est un boxeur portoricain né le 15 mars 1963 Toa Baja (Porto Rico) et mort le 1er décembre 1997 dans la même ville.Passé professionnel en 1979, il remporte le titre de champion du monde des poids légers WBC laissé vacant par Alexis Arguello en battant aux points José Luis Ramírez le 1er mai 1983 (Ramírez prendra sa revanche le 3 novembre 1984).Le 26 septembre 1986, Rosario s'empare de la ceinture WBA aux dépens de Livingstone Bramble par KO dans le 2e reprise mais s'incline face à Julio César Chávez le 21 novembre 1987. Il remporte une seconde fois cette ceinture laissée rapidement vacante par Chavez en stoppant au 6e round Anthony Jones le 9 juillet 1989, ceinture qu'il perd dès le combat suivant face à Juan Nazario.
